Mitla Cafe

602 North Mount Vernon Avenue, San Bernardino, CA - (909) 888-0460

Along with thousands of locals, we've been coming to this restaurant for years. Make it a point to take your out of town guests for the best Mexican food around. When you step in the door, you'll know you're in a local eatery that cares more for its food than its surroundings. But, for what the restaurant lacks in decoration and ambiance, it definitely makes up for in its cuisine.

There is a reason this restaurant has been around for 70 years. The food is great! If you're not a local that's been coming here your entire life, the service will be lacking but the authentic Mexican cuisine will be worth it. Be sure to try the carne ssada dinner and albondigas soup. In between the amazing chips, salsa and guacamole course and your entree comes a strange little salad with a mayonnaise-type dressing (no choice). This is more evidence of the authenticity of the restaurant's Mexican heritage. There is nothing on the menu that comes out of a can. It is all handmade, including their chips and hand-tossed corn and flour tortillas.
